Highlights
Are people in Milan older or younger than people in Madrid?
- The Median Age in Milan is 5.0 years younger than in Madrid.

Are housing costs cheaper in Milan or Madrid?
- Milan housing costs are 39.3% more expensive than Madrid hous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Milan or Madrid?
- The average commute for residents of Milan is 6.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of Madrid.

Things to do in Madrid?
Living in Madrid, NE is a great experience. The small town atmosphere makes it feel like home and the people are friendly and welcoming. This area of Nebraska is full of wide open spaces and plenty of outdoor activities to enjoy. There are several beautiful parks, lakes, and trails to explore in and around town. As a resident of Madrid you can take part in local events like the Madrid Pioneer Days Festival which is held every summer. Shopping and dining options can be found along the main street as well as at the city’s two grocery stores. Residents also have access to excellent healthcare facilities and emergency services nearby if needed. Madrid is a great place to live with its lovely small town atmosphere, warm neighbors, and vast outdoor recreational opportunities!

Things to do in Milan?
Living in Milan, IL is an incredibly rewarding experience. The small town of about 5,000 people is situated along the Rock River and offers a peaceful and quiet atmosphere surrounded by beauty. Residents enjoy easy access to outdoor recreation such as fishing, boating, camping and golfing. Milan also boasts plenty of shopping options as well as a variety of restaurants to choose from. In addition to its natural beauty, Milan is home to various parks and recreational facilities that offer something for everyone. With its friendly citizens, vibrant culture and rich history, it's no wonder why Milan is such a great place to call home!
